You didn't give us the Routerstats graph following the one you supplied. One of the major advantages of RS over DMT is that it continues after a resync. The behaviour then can give a clue as to the type of event that caused the disconnection.
It looked like you have a fairly high sampling interval as well. That's fine for a rough guide, but for serious diagnostics I much prefer 5 seconds. Logging to file as well as graphing can be useful as well, if you aren't doing that. Scanning the log is sometimes easier than the graphs if the person looking isn't using the machine the graphs are on, so can't flick through them.
